Podcast: Client Confidentiality in the Age of Coronavirus
Read Time: 1 minWhat might be reasonable efforts as required by the lawyer professional conduct rules?
Confidentiality is fundamental to the client-lawyer relationship. It encourages candid communication between client and lawyer and assists the lawyer in more effectively representing the client.
In this episode, McGlinchey General Counsel Christine Lipsey discusses that, in the age of Coronavirus and work from home, there are additional factors for lawyers to consider. We all need to be especially sensitive to maintaining these essential protections.
